Sexual Harassment: A Commonsense Approach -- Employee Version  

True-to-life scenes in this sexual harassment training video show how awareness, communication and civility can lead to the prevention of sexual harassment in the workplace.

Isn't it just amazing? Even after huge settlements and attention-grabbing headlines, sexual harassment continues to occur in our workplaces. And while some people still behave badly, others may overreact to minor slights that don't really qualify as sexual harassment. Either way, unwelcome conduct is bad news for employers.

This dramatic sexual harasmment video training program is designed to help your employees with both the gray areas and the obvious. Viewers will see realistic scenes that are clearly sexual harassment, and others that are probably just a lapse in good judgment.

  • Is it ever OK to hug someone at work?
  • Are compliments ever appropriate?
  • How much joking around is acceptable?
  • Is it illegal for employees to date?

In this video, experts in the field, trainer Linda Garrett and attorney Brandon Blevans, add their insights to help you distinguish what is—and what is not—sexual harassment, in various settings, including manufacturing, office, healthcare and academic environments. Viewers will learn how to recognize sexual harassment, how to respond appropriately, and how to behave in compliance with the law and your policies.
